Dakshin Charai Khia

Dakshin Charai Khia is a village located in Contai I subdivision of Purba Medinipur district in West Bengal, India. Tamluk and Contai are the district & sub-district headquarters of Dakshin Charai Khia village respectively. As per 2009 stats, Haipur is the gram panchayat of Dakshin Charai Khia village.

About Dakshin Charai Khia

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Dakshin Charai Khia is 346067. The village spans a total geographical area of 133.55 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 721452. Contai is nearest town to Dakshin Charai Khia village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 10km away.

Population of Dakshin Charai Khia

According to the 2011 Census, Dakshin Charai Khia has a total population of about 1,738, with approximately 880 males and 858 females. The sex ratio is around 975 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 163 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 301 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 4. The overall literacy rate is approximately 83.60%, with male literacy at about 85.11% and female literacy near 82.05%. There are around 387 households in the village. Connectivity of Dakshin Charai Khia

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Dakshin Charai Khia. As per the 2011 stats, Dakshin Charai Khia had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
